Authenticated session impersonation via untracked SAML IDs
Published Jul 30, 2024 · Updated Jan 9, 2025
Authentication bypass in Perforce Akana API Platform before 2024.1.0 allows remote authenticated users to replay SAML tokens. At SSO login, the platform failed to persist previously accepted SAML response or assertion IDs, so it could not reject reuse of an accepted token. Access to a valid token and a deployment using SAML Web SSO are required, and replay can expose or alter data within the impersonated session.
